Altair's packages address challenges in various interdisciplinary domains, including structural, thermal, electrical, electromagnetic, acoustics, and vibrations. The accurate prediction of results provided by Altair's software contributes to reducing prototype costs, which is a significant benefit in the development process.
I find the HyperMesh tool from Altair to be highly effective in meshing plastic and BIW components, especially when compared to other software options. Additionally, Altair's Optistruct solver stands out as the best choice for performing static analysis.
While Altair's software offers excellent capabilities, there is still room for improvement, particularly in the area of contact and material modeling. In some static cases, I encountered issues where the contacts were not functioning effectively.
Flexible set up, customized reports in BOARd and Excel, the smaller size of vendors, integration with SAP, CRM MS Dynamics and Cognos TM1, strong database structure.
Rarely crashes occur due to Excel Add-ins. Datamart is needed to purchase it as a BI tool.
